Graduates of Hamline University's master's program in Education earn a median $69,775 one year after graduating, rising to $93,145 by year ten. Five years out, earnings run 17% above the national median of $69,841 for this field, ranking 29th of 335 reporting programs.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au PSEO, release V4.13.0 2025Q4. Earnings are for graduates working in covered states; figures are medians in nominal dollars.
